- Timestamp:
- 2017-04-13T16:21:08+02:00 (7 years ago)
- Location:
- branches/2017/dev_r7881_no_wrk_alloc/NEMOGCM/NEMO/NST_SRC
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
branches/2017/dev_r7881_no_wrk_alloc/NEMOGCM/NEMO/NST_SRC/agrif_opa_interp.F90
r7646 r7910 28 28 USE agrif_opa_sponge 29 29 USE lib_mpp 30 USE wrk_nemo31 30 32 31 IMPLICIT NONE … … 77 76 INTEGER :: ji, jj, jk ! dummy loop indices 78 77 INTEGER :: j1, j2, i1, i2 79 REAL(wp), POINTER, DIMENSION(:,:) :: zub, zvb78 REAL(wp), DIMENSION(jpi,jpj) :: zub, zvb 80 79 !!---------------------------------------------------------------------- 81 80 ! 82 81 IF( Agrif_Root() ) RETURN 83 82 ! 84 CALL wrk_alloc( jpi,jpj, zub, zvb )85 83 ! 86 84 Agrif_SpecialValue = 0._wp … … 376 374 ENDIF 377 375 ! 378 CALL wrk_dealloc( jpi,jpj, zub, zvb )379 376 ! 380 377 END SUBROUTINE Agrif_dyn -
branches/2017/dev_r7881_no_wrk_alloc/NEMOGCM/NEMO/NST_SRC/agrif_opa_sponge.F90
r7646 r7910 14 14 USE in_out_manager 15 15 USE agrif_oce 16 USE wrk_nemo17 16 USE lbclnk ! ocean lateral boundary conditions (or mpp link) 18 17 … … 88 87 LOGICAL :: ll_spdone 89 88 REAL(wp) :: z1spongearea, zramp 90 REAL(wp), POINTER, DIMENSION(:,:) :: ztabramp89 REAL(wp), DIMENSION(jpi,jpj) :: ztabramp 91 90 92 91 #if defined SPONGE || defined SPONGE_TOP … … 98 97 ll_spdone=.FALSE. 99 98 100 CALL wrk_alloc( jpi, jpj, ztabramp )101 99 102 100 ispongearea = 2 + nn_sponge_len * Agrif_irhox() … … 185 183 ENDIF 186 184 ! 187 IF (.NOT.ll_spdone) CALL wrk_dealloc( jpi, jpj, ztabramp )188 185 ! 189 186 #endif
Note: See TracChangeset
for help on using the changeset viewer.